This API returns CMC performance usage data for the partitions of the managed systems.
Important: The versions v1 and v2 have the same response syntax.
For details about this API and the sample request and response, see Usage Managed System Partition.
Use the following table to review the syntax of the API and the description of the API response parameters.
| Parameter | Description |
| { | |
| "Partitions": [ | Array for details of the partitions. |
| { | |
| "Name": "string", | Partition name. |
| "ID": "string", | Partition ID. |
| "State": "string", | State of the partition. |
| "OSType": "string", | OS type. |
| "OSVersion": "string", | OS version. |
| "PartitionType": "string", | Type of the partition. |
| "UUID": "string", | Partition UUID. |
| "Tags": [ | Array to give details of the tags. |
| { | |
| "Name": "string" | Name. |
| } | |
| ], | |
| "Usage": { | Usage details. |
| "CoreUsage": { | Core usage details. |
| "Average": "number", | Average core usage. |
| "Min": "number", | Minimum core usage. |
| "Max": "number" | Maximum core usage. |
| }, | |
| "MemoryUsage": { | Memory usage details. |
| "Average": "number", | Average memory usage. |
| "Min": "number", | Minimum memory usage. |
| "Max": "number" | Maximum memory usage. |
| }, | |
| "NetworkUsage": { | Network usage details. |
| "SentBytes": { | Details of sent bytes. |
| "Average": "number", | Average bytes sent. |
| "Min": "number", | Minimum bytes sent. |
| "Max": "number" | Maximum bytes sent. |
| }, | |
| "ReceivedBytes": { | Details of received bytes. |
| "Average": "number", | Average bytes received. |
| "Min": "number", | Minimum bytes received. |
| "Max": "number" | Maximum bytes received. |
| }, | |
| "SentPackets": { | Details of sent packets. |
| "Average": "number", | Average sent packets. |
| "Min": "number", | Minimum sent packets. |
| "Max": "number" | Maximum sent packets. |
| }, | |
| "ReceivedPackets": { | Details of received packets. |
| "Average": "number", | Average received packets. |
| "Min": "number", | Minimum received packets. |
| "Max": "number" | Maximum received packets. |
| } | |
| }, | |
| "StorageUsage": { | Details of storage usage. |
| "ReadBytes": { | Details of bytes read. |
| "Average": "number", | Average bytes read. |
| "Min": "number", | Minimum bytes read. |
| "Max": "number" | Maximum bytes read. |
| }, | |
| "WriteBytes": { | Details of bytes written. |
| "Average": "number", | Average bytes written. |
| "Min": "number", | Minimum bytes written. |
| "Max": "number" | Maximum bytes written. |
| }, | |
| "NumOfReads": { | Details of number of reads. |
| "Average": "number", | Average number of reads. |
| "Min": "number", | Minimum number of reads. |
| "Max": "number" | Maximum number of reads. |
| }, | |
| "NumOfWrites": { | Details of number of writes. |
| "Average": "number", | Average number of writes. |
| "Min": "number", | Minimum number of writes. |
| "Max": "number" | Maximum number of writes. |
| }, | |
| "NPIVUsage": { | NPIV usage details. |
| "ReadBytes": { | Details of bytes read. |
| "Average": "number", | Average bytes read. |
| "Min": "number", | Minimum bytes read. |
| "Max": "number" | Maximum bytes read. |
| }, | |
| "WriteBytes": { | Details of bytes written. |
| "Average": "number", | Average bytes written. |
| "Min": "number", | Minimum bytes written. |
| "Max": "number" | Maximum bytes written. |
| }, | |
| "NumOfReads": { | Details of number of reads. |
| "Average": "number", | Average number of reads. |
| "Min": "number", | Minimum number of reads. |
| "Max": "number" | Maximum number of reads. |
| }, | |
| "NumOfWrites": { | Details of number of writes. |
| "Average": "number", | Average number of writes. |
| "Min": "number", | Minimum number of writes. |
| "Max": "number" | Maximum number of writes. |
| } | |
| }, | |
| "VirtualSCSIUsage": { | Virtual SCSI usage details. |
| "ReadBytes": { | Details of bytes read. |
| "Average": "number", | Average bytes read. |
| "Min": "number", | Minimum bytes read. |
| "Max": "number" | Maximum bytes read. |
| }, | |
| "WriteBytes": { | Details of bytes written. |
| "Average": "number", | Average bytes written. |
| "Min": "number", | Minimum bytes written. |
| "Max": "number" | Maximum bytes written. |
| }, | |
| "NumOfReads": { | Details of number of reads. |
| "Average": "number", | Average number of reads. |
| "Min": "number", | Minimum number of reads. |
| "Max": "number" | Maximum number of reads. |
| }, | |
| "NumOfWrites": { | Details of number of writes. |
| "Average": "number", | Average number of writes. |
| "Min": "number", | Minimum number of writes. |
| "Max": "number" | Maximum number of writes. |
| } | |
| } | |
| }, | |
| "Frequency": "string", | Frequency of usage. |
| "Usage": [ | Array to give details of usage. |
| { | |
| "StartTime": "string", | Start time of usage. |
| "CoreUsage": "number", | Core usage. |
| "MemoryUsage": "number", | Memory usage. |
| "NetworkUsage": { | Network usage details. |
| "SentBytes": "number", | Number of bytes sent. |
| "ReceivedBytes": "number", | Number of bytes received. |
| "SentPackets": "number", | Number of packets sent. |
| "ReceivedPackets": "number" | Number of packets received. |
| }, | |
| "StorageUsage": { | Storage usage details. |
| "ReadBytes": "number", | Number of bytes read. |
| "WriteBytes": "number", | Number of bytes written. |
| "NumOfReads": "number", | Number of reads. |
| "NumOfWrites": "number", | Number of writes. |
| "NPIVUsage": { | NPIV usage details. |
| "ReadBytes": "number", | Number of bytes read. |
| "WriteBytes": "number", | Number of bytes written. |
| "NumOfReads": "number", | Number of reads. |
| "NumOfWrites": "number" | Number of writes. |
| }, | |
| "VirtualSCSIUsage": { | Virtual SCSI usage details. |
| "ReadBytes": "number", | Number of bytes read. |
| "WriteBytes": "number", | Number of bytes written. |
| "NumOfReads": "number", | Number of reads. |
| "NumOfWrites": "number" | Number of writes. |
| } | |
| } | |
| } | |
| ] | |
| } | |
| } | |
| ] | |
| } |
Comments
0 comments
Please sign in to leave a comment.